Recently I have been asked about installing Linux on some laptops and
other
PC'sthese are at present in the MS stronghold, but frustration of the
daily
reboot has led the owners to
look at alternatives.
The requirememnts are simple and I think indicative of many a current
frustrated MS WIn95 user.
the need to maintain compatiblity for file exchange with other Win95
users,
mailnly in Word for Windows and Excel .
OK before you guys rave about Applix and StarOffice, they do maintain
some
compatibilty but very poor by my tests to date. Fine on simple docs,
but on
100 page reports with embedded graphics and imported spreadsheet data,
forget
it.
If this worked , I would have several converts right now.

I have seen many wanting to go to Linux, but being forced to remain in
Win95
because of this file compatiblity issue.
